1. Unleashing AI and Machine Learning: Tools to Measure Employee Performance Effectively
In today's fast-paced workplace, the integration of AI and machine learning is revolutionizing the way organizations assess employee performance. A study by McKinsey found that companies that effectively implement AI in their performance evaluation processes see a 20% increase in productivity . By utilizing advanced algorithms, employers can analyze vast amounts of data to gauge not only how employees are performing but also to predict future outcomes based on existing trends. For instance, performance management platforms equipped with AI can offer insights into employee engagement and satisfaction levels, directly linking them to productivity metrics. Such tools, which harness the power of real-time feedback and analytics, allow leaders to make data-driven decisions that foster a more productive work environment.
Furthermore, machine learning algorithms are capable of identifying patterns in employee performance data that human evaluators might overlook. A survey conducted by Deloitte revealed that 77% of organizations believe these technologies can enhance their performance management processes . By utilizing objective metrics and personalized performance improvements, AI-driven tools enable tailored development plans, thereby equipping employees with the resources they need to succeed. Companies leveraging these innovative solutions can create a culture of continuous improvement, ensuring that every team member is not just meeting expectations but excelling in their roles. The real-world impact of these technologies is profound, as organizations that adopt AI-driven performance evaluation systems report higher employee retention rates and a more engaged workforce.
2. The Rise of Real-Time Feedback Tools: Enhance Productivity with Continuous Improvement
Real-time feedback tools have emerged as pivotal technologies in the realm of performance evaluation, driving continuous improvement and enhancing workplace productivity. Unlike traditional performance reviews, which often occur annually, these tools facilitate ongoing dialogue between employees and managers. For instance, platforms like TINYpulse and Officevibe enable organizations to gather employee sentiments through pulse surveys and instant feedback mechanisms. A study by Harvard Business Review emphasizes that companies implementing regular feedback systems report a 14.9% increase in employee engagement, directly correlating that engagement with improved productivity outcomes . Such tools not only provide immediate insights but also foster a culture of transparency and adaptability, allowing teams to pivot quickly based on real-time data.
Moreover, integrating real-time feedback tools can streamline performance evaluation processes, making them more agile and responsive. For example, Performance Management software like 15Five encourages managers to give weekly feedback and set short-term goals, akin to a coach providing constant guidance to an athlete, which helps maintain high performance levels. By leveraging these tools, organizations can not only enhance overall productivity but also increase employee satisfaction, evidenced by a Gallup survey revealing that employees who receive regular feedback have higher job satisfaction rates . To maximize the benefits of real-time feedback, companies should invest in training for both managers and employees on how to utilize these tools effectively, creating a supportive environment for continuous improvement.
3. Gamification in Performance Evaluation: Boost Engagement with Proven Strategies
Gamification in performance evaluation is transforming the traditional workplace into a dynamic environment that stimulates engagement and productivity. A startling 85% of employees report feeling disengaged at work, according to Gallup . To combat this, companies are increasingly integrating gamification strategies that harness elements of play into their evaluation processes. For instance, a study by the University of North Carolina found that organizations implementing gamification in their evaluations saw a 27% increase in employee engagement and a remarkable 24% boost in productivity . By introducing leaderboards, points systems, and achievement badges, businesses not only motivate their employees but also create a sense of community and healthy competition that drives performance levels upward.
Moreover, incorporating gamified elements in performance evaluations aligns closely with the preferences of today's workforce, especially millennials and Gen Z, who thrive in competitive and interactive environments. According to research from TalentLMS, 83% of employees would be more motivated to work if their company used gamification techniques . Companies such as Deloitte have embraced this trend, reporting that gamification in performance reviews has led to more transparent and effective evaluations, reducing the time spent on feedback while increasing employee satisfaction by 42%. As businesses continue to adapt to emerging technologies, the use of gamified tools not only boosts engagement but also fosters a culture of continuous improvement, ultimately leading to enhanced workplace productivity.
4. Leveraging Big Data Analytics: Transforming Performance Metrics into Actionable Insights
Leveraging big data analytics allows organizations to transform performance metrics into actionable insights by utilizing comprehensive datasets to identify patterns, trends, and correlations that drive results. For instance, a study by Gartner highlighted that 64% of organizations that implemented big data analytics saw measurable improvements in their decision-making processes (Gartner, 2021). By collecting data from various sources such as employee performance reviews, sales figures, and customer feedback, companies can construct a clearer picture of productivity drivers. A real-world example is Google, which employs big data analytics to analyze employee performance metrics and determine optimal work environments, subsequently designing spaces that enhance collaboration and efficiency. Companies should implement user-friendly data visualization tools to help stakeholders easily interpret these insights and foster a culture of data-driven decision-making (McKinsey, 2021).
Furthermore, big data analytics can enhance predictive performance evaluation, allowing companies to anticipate outcomes based on historical data. This proactive approach can be likened to a weather forecast that enables individuals to plan their activities around expected conditions. A notable example is IBM's Watson, which assists organizations in predicting employee turnover by analyzing various factors such as job satisfaction and performance trends (IBM, 2021). To effectively leverage big data in performance evaluation, businesses should focus on data quality, integrate multiple data sources, and ensure a robust analytics infrastructure. Moreover, training employees to understand and utilize analytics tools can enhance their engagement with these insights, leading to improved outcomes and productivity (Harvard Business Review, 2022).

5. Collaborative Performance Management Platforms: Streamlining Team Efficiency and Accountability
As organizations strive to enhance productivity in an increasingly competitive landscape, collaborative performance management platforms are emerging as pivotal tools to streamline team efficiency and accountability. According to a study by McKinsey & Company, firms that embrace digital collaboration can expect a 20-25% increase in productivity . By integrating real-time feedback systems and project management capabilities, these platforms allow teams to set clear, shared objectives while continuously tracking their progress. For instance, Asana and Trello have reported that users experience a 45% gain in team alignment through the use of collaborative features that keep everyone accountable and engaged in their collective goals .
Moreover, the shift towards a more holistic performance evaluation approach is backed by statistics showing that 94% of employees state they would stay at a company longer if it invested in their career development . By leveraging collaborative platforms, organizations not only enable transparent communication but also empower employees to take ownership of their performance. Research from Deloitte indicates that companies utilizing collaborative performance management tools see employee engagement scores rise by up to 20%, further linking productivity to a culture of accountability and teamwork . This integration of technology and human resources creates a dynamic environment where both individual and collective achievements are recognized, fostering an atmosphere of continuous improvement and innovation.
6. Integrating Predictive Analytics: Anticipating Workplace Challenges for Proactive Solutions
Integrating predictive analytics into workplace dynamics can significantly enhance performance evaluation by anticipating challenges before they occur. For instance, software like Microsoft Power BI leverages machine learning to provide insights into employee performance trends by analyzing historical data. Companies such as IBM have successfully utilized predictive analytics to identify potential employee attrition, allowing them to implement targeted retention strategies. A study from Deloitte highlights that organizations utilizing predictive analytics can increase their operational efficiency by up to 20%, as they can proactively address performance-related issues rather than reacting to them after they arise.
To maximize the benefits of predictive analytics, businesses can adopt a systematic approach to data integration, pairing qualitative assessments with quantitative data. Tools like SAP SuccessFactors not only provide performance evaluation metrics but also use predictive capabilities to recommend development programs tailored to individual employee needs. This could be compared to a sports team analyzing past performances to refine game strategies, ensuring that each player’s strengths are maximized. Additionally, companies should invest in employee training on how to interpret predictive insights, as a survey by McKinsey indicates that organizations that effectively combine machine learning with human judgment see a significant increase in productivity and engagement.
7. Case Studies of Success: How Top Companies Use Emerging Technologies to Drive Results
In the relentless pursuit of productivity, companies like Microsoft and IBM have harnessed the power of emerging technologies such as Artificial Intelligence (AI) and machine learning to revolutionize performance evaluation. A notable case study is Microsoft's use of its own AI-driven tools, which has led to a staggering 20% increase in employee engagement, as reported in their annual productivity reports. By leveraging data analytics, Microsoft not only tracks employee performance but also predicts future outcomes, allowing for timely interventions. Similarly, IBM's Watson can analyze vast datasets, enabling managers to tailor feedback and training programs to individual employee needs. This personalized approach has reportedly boosted productivity metrics by 15% within one year of implementation .
Another powerful example can be observed in the fast-paced world of retail, where Walmart has embraced advanced performance evaluation technologies. Utilizing IoT and big data analytics, Walmart has optimized its workforce management, resulting in a remarkable 10% reduction in labor costs while simultaneously improving service quality. According to a study by McKinsey, businesses that effectively leverage data analytics can experience up to a 25% increase in productivity . By integrating these emerging technologies, Walmart not only drives operational efficiency but also strengthens its competitive edge in the market, demonstrating the transformative impact of data-driven performance evaluations in real-world applications.
